.z_content {	width: 1400px;	margin: 0 auto;}.index_icon {	font-size: 16px;	color: #446fc7;}.bread_nav {	height: 30px;	line-height: 30px;	margin-top: 20px;}.bread_nav>li {	float: left;	margin-right: 12px;	font-size: 14px;	color: #333333;	font-weight: bold;}.bread_nav>li>a {	font-size: 14px;	color: #333333;	font-weight: bold;}.bread_nav>li>.bread_active {	color:#cd944b;;	font-weight: bold;}.team_title {	position: relative;	width: 1265px;	height: 170px;	background-image: url(../images/duction.png);	background-size: 395px 142px;	background-position: 0 0;	background-repeat: no-repeat;	margin: 0 auto;	padding-top: 0.1px;	margin-top: 36px;}.sp_title {	display: block;	font-size: 50px;	color: #446fc7;	text-align: center;	margin-top: 70px;}.small_jy {	position: absolute;	width: 126px;	height: 12px;	right: 0;	bottom: 0;}@media screen and (max-width: 1400px) {	.z_content {		width: 1200px;	}}.type_team_content {	width: 1265px;	height: auto;	background-color: #f8f8f8;	margin: 0 auto;	margin-top: 30px;	box-shadow: 0px 0px 100px #f6f6f6;}.type_team {	width: 100%;	/*height: 55px;*/	line-height: 55px;}.team_nav_tit {	float: left;	width: 90px;	text-align: center;	font-size: 14px;	color: #787878;	font-weight: bold;}.team_nav {	width: calc(100% - 90px);	width: -webkit-calc(100% - 90px);	background-color: #FFFFFF;	float: left;	border-bottom: 1px solid #e8e8e8;	padding-left: 45px;}.team_nav:last-child {	/*border-bottom:none;*/}.team_nav>li {	float: left;	margin-right: 50px;	font-size: 14px;	color: #222222;	font-weight: bold;	cursor: pointer;}.team_nav>.team_on {	color: #446fc7;}.shaixuan_content {	width: 1265px;	margin: 20px auto;	height: 25px;	line-height: 25px;}.son_nav {	display: inline-block;	font-size: 14px;	color: #333333;	border: 1px solid #e8e8e8;	padding: 0 10px;	height: 25px;	margin-left: 18px;	cursor: pointer;}.selectList {	float: left;}.cha {	font-size: 14px;	color: #446fc7;	margin-left: 5px;}.shaixuan_title {	font-size: 14px;	color: #333333;	float: left;	width: 90px;	text-align: center;}.sonNav_del {	font-size: 14px;	color: #333333;	cursor: pointer;}.del_icon {	font-size: 14px;	color: #333333;	margin-left: 20px;}.team_content {	width: 1550px;	/* min-height: 1550px; */	margin: 0 auto;	margin-top: 110px;}.team_list {	float: left;	width: 47.8%;	height: 442px;	box-shadow: 0px 5px 20px #ebebeb;	margin-right: 55px;	margin-bottom: 55px;}.team_list:nth-child(2n) {	margin-right: 0;}.team_list:last-child {	margin-right: 0;}.team_people {	/*width: 45%;*/	height: 100%;	float: left;}.peo_details {	float: left;	width: 55%;	height: 100%;	padding: 28px 32px;	position: relative;}.peo_name {	display: block;	font-size: 25px;	color: #333333;	font-weight: bold;}.peo_tip {	font-size: 16px;	color: #666666;}.peo_img {	display: flex;	justify-content: center;	align-items: center;	width: 18px;	height: 18px;	float: left;	margin-right: 5px;}.sheji_li{    display: -webkit-box;    -webkit-box-orient: vertical;    -webkit-line-clamp: 2;    overflow: hidden;}.sheji_xiang{    display: -webkit-box;    -webkit-box-orient: vertical;    -webkit-line-clamp: 3;    overflow: overlay;}}.details_list {	margin-top: 37px;}.details_list>li {	margin-top: 10px;}.peo_cnm {	position: absolute;	right: 0;	top: 60px;	width: 113px;	height: 63px;}.peo_btn {	position: absolute;	right: 32px;	bottom: 28px;	width: 162px;	height: 42px;	background-color: #446fc7;	color: #FFFFFF;	font-size: 16px;	text-align: center;	line-height: 42px;	cursor: pointer;}.details_list>ul>li>span {	font-size: 14px;	color: #666666;}@media screen and (max-width:1500px) {	.team_content {		width: 1200px;	}	.team_list {		height: 353px;		margin-right: 15px;		margin-bottom: 35px;	}	.peo_details {		float: left;		width: 55%;		height: 100%;		padding: 18px 22px;		position: relative;	}	.peo_name {		display: block;		font-size: 25px;		color: #333333;		font-weight: bold;	}	.peo_btn {		right: 22px;		bottom: 18px;		width: 140px;		height: 36px;		background-color: #446fc7;		color: #FFFFFF;		font-size: 14px;		text-align: center;		line-height: 36px;		cursor: pointer;	}	.details_list {		margin-top: 20px;	}	.peo_cnm {		position: absolute;		right: 0;		top: 100px;		width: 80px;		height: 44px;	}	/* .team_content {		min-height: 1260px;	} */}/*.M-box{*//*	width: 470px;*//*	margin: 0 auto;*//*	margin-bottom: 50px;*//*}*//*.M-box>span{*//*	display: block;*//*	width: 36px;*//*	height: 36px;*//*	float: left;*//*	text-align: center;*//*	line-height: 36px;*//*	border: 1px solid #c6c6c6;*//*	color: #C6C6C6;*//*	font-size: 16px;*//*	margin-right: 10px;*//*}*//*.M-box>a{*//*	display: block;*//*	width: 36px;*//*	height: 36px;*//*	float: left;*//*	text-align: center;*//*	line-height: 36px;*//*	border: 1px solid #c6c6c6;*//*	color: #C6C6C6;*//*	font-size: 16px;*//*	margin-right: 10px;*//*}*/.M-box{  width: 100%;  text-align: center;  margin-bottom: 50px;}.M-box>span{  display: inline-block;  width: 36px;  height: 36px;  text-align: center;  line-height: 36px;  border: 1px solid #c6c6c6;  color: #C6C6C6;  font-size: 16px;  margin-right: 10px;}.M-box>a{  display: inline-block;  width: 36px;  height: 36px;  text-align: center;  line-height: 36px;  border: 1px solid #c6c6c6;  color: #C6C6C6;  font-size: 16px;  margin-right: 10px;}.M-box>a:hover{	color: #FFFFFF;	background-color: #446fc7;	border: 1px solid #446fc7;}.M-box>span:hover{	color: #FFFFFF;	background-color: #446fc7;	border: 1px solid #446fc7;}.M-box>.active{	color: #FFFFFF;	background-color: #446fc7;	border: 1px solid #446fc7;}